Calling Q parameter functions

When you are writing a part program, press the “Q” key (in the
numeric keypad for numerical input and axis selection, below the
+/-). The TNC then displays the following soft keys:

The TNC shows the soft keys Q, QL and QR when
you are defining or assigning a Q parameter. First
press one of these soft keys to select the desired
type of parameter, and then enter the parameter
number.

If you have a USB keyboard connected, you can
press the Q key to open the dialog for entering a
formula.
